I have had 2 calls in the last 2 weeks in Queensland, same scenario, Indian man & he had my name. I was immediately suspicious of the call to the mobile as it is rarely given out. When I questioned the date of the accident - he said because of the privacy act, he couldn't tell me. When I asked the rego number, same reply. I did notice the caller ID on the mobile & it seemed to be a Melbourne City Number started with 03900xxxxx. It rattled me so I rang the ACCC to report it. The lady there took my report & said it was a scam. The caller would continue asking questions & some people have given out their Bank details to hurry up a claim. The ACCC said these people would have bought a listing from somewhere that had my rarely quoted mobile number on it. Perhaps from a car dealer service department years ago because we have to quote it when the car is serviced so they can ring me when it's ready to pick up. Both the mobile & landline are on the "Do not call register" but it doesn't seem to stop these people. I also get the calls supposedly from Microsoft about the computer that I don't have. From now on if I answer the phone & realise it's a call centre I will simply hang up.

I received a call today 30/03/17 from "Accident Helpline" in Sydney. An Indian woman with the name of Eva claimed to have details of an accident I was involved in a year ago. According to her, the details were given to her by a Government Department who had the police report. She told me, she was able to contact me by using the details from the report. The report said, I had been rear ended by another motor vehicle. I asked her for more details. She promptly stopped.

At first she old me that Accident Helpline is a Government organisation investigating accidents however she could not call me by name or reveal how she really got my number when asked. I told her, my number was an unlisted number. I asked her for the company's phone number, caller ID and ACN. I asked, why she was calling instead of the police and why the police gave the company the report which contravenes the Privacy ACT. I wanted to know who I needed to take legal action against for passing on these details to her. She replied, "we are a legitimate company, just Google and I would see" . Eva wouldn't give me a phone number but she gave me an ACN (02) 8006 9854 which is not an ACN but their phone number. I asked her for contact number, she hung up.

No more than half an hour later, she rang back and hung up on me. This is not the first time I have received calls from these people, in all I have had about 20 calls over the past thee years. It's the same thing every time they call.
